allarminda 's review for:
The End of Your Life Book Club
by Will Schwalbe
I don't know what compelled me to read this book, except I love books and the idea of a book about a book club, albeit a two-member one, and one of those members is dying, rather intrigued me.
Whatever my initial impulse, I couldn't be more grateful to Mr. Schwalbe and his willingness to share this remarkable story. And lest you have any misgivings, this story is not about the book club Will and his mother created, but rather the most loving and befitting tribute from a devoted son to his mother's legacy.
